OBJECTIVE To establish an evaluation method for the release of mupirocin ointment in vitro, according to the quality research of ointment preparations at home and abroad and the technical guidelines for generic drugs. METHODS The diffusion cell method was adopted, the release membrane was polyethersulfone membrane, the receiving medium was sodium dihydrogen phosphate buffer solution with pH 7.4, the rotation speed was 600 r·min-1, and the sample size was 300 mg. The concentration of mupirocin in the receiving solution at different time points was determined by HPLC method, and the cumulative release and release rate were calculated. The particle size morphology and particle size distribution of mupirocin ointment from different manufacturers were determined by particle size analyzer. The viscosity of preparations from different manufacturers was determined by rheometer. RESULTS The determination method for the release of mupirocin ointment in vitro was established, and the precision, durability and discrimination of this method were good, and the consistency evaluation was made for preparations from different manufacturers. There were great differences in particle size distribution and viscosity between different manufacturers. CONCLUSION The differences in particle size distribution between different manufacturers reflect the differences in preparation production process, and the differences in viscosity reflect the differences in preparation prescription, both of them can affect the release rate of mupirocin ointment in vitro.

目的 根据国内外软膏类制剂质量研究及仿制药技术指导原则,建立莫匹罗星软膏体外释放评价方法。方法 采用扩散池法,释放膜为聚醚砜膜,接收介质为pH 7.4的磷酸二氢钠缓冲液,转速为600 r·min-1,上样量为300 mg;采用高效液相色谱(HPLC)法测定不同时间点接收液中莫匹罗星的浓度,计算累积释放量及释放速率。采用粒度粒型仪对不同厂家莫匹罗星软膏粒子形态及粒度分布进行测定。采用流变仪对不同厂家制剂黏度进行测定。结果 建立了莫匹罗星软膏体外释放测定方法,此方法精密度、耐用性及区分力均较好,并对不同厂家制剂做了一致性评价。不同厂家制剂之间粒度分布及黏度存在较大不同。结论 不同厂家制剂之间粒度分布存在差异反映出制剂生产工艺的不同,黏度的差异反映出制剂处方的不同,二者可共同影响莫匹罗星软膏体外释放速率。
